Within the framework of the Uzbekistan Cup quarterfinal stage in the city of Tashkent, a tense and dramatic match awaited by the fans took place. "Bunyodkor" hosted the "Bukhara" team on its own field, and the struggle took place in a fully lively atmosphere.
Both teams started to act in an attacking style from the very first minutes. In the match held with great interest, the score was opened in the 6th minute by Azizbek Amonov for the guests. However, shortly after, in the 12th minute, Najmiddin Normurodov equalized the score for the hosts with a very beautiful strike and gifted the fans an impressive "super goal".
But "Bukhara" soon regained the initiative, and in the 37th minute, Toma Tabatadze scored the second goal for his team. His aggressive play drastically changed the direction of the match. At the beginning of the second half, "Bunyodkor" also managed to respond — in the 55th minute, Matija Krivokapic equalized the score again.
After that, the tension on the field kept increasing. In the 68th minute, Toma Tabatadze scored accurately from the penalty spot, completing a double and taking "Bukhara" ahead once more. In the final minutes of the clash, in the 87th minute, Frane Ikic scored a goal and brought the score to a large 4:2.
Thus, in a match full of struggles, "Bukhara" achieved a deserved victory and secured a ticket to the semifinals of the Uzbekistan Cup. This result can be considered one of the most important stages in the club's new history.
Uzbekistan Cup. Quarterfinal
Bunyodkor – Bukhara 2:4
Goals: Azizbek Amonov (6) — 0:1, Najmiddin Normurodov (12) — 1:1, Toma Tabatadze (37) — 1:2, Matija Krivokapic (55) — 2:2, Toma Tabatadze (68, penalty) — 2:3, Frane Ikic (87) — 2:4.
Bunyodkor lineup: Abdumavlon Abdujalilov, Najmiddin Normurodov, Marko Bugarin, Nikoloz Mali (Farrukh Qodirov, 77), Itsuki Urata, Rasul Yuldoshev, Martin Sroler (Ollobergan Karimov, 74), Temurkhuzha Abdukholiqov, Amir To‘raqulov, Imeda Ashortia (Sardor Abdunabiev, 74), Matija Krivokapic.
Bukhara lineup: Otabek Boimurodov, Muhammad Yuldashev, Frane Ikic, Marko Kolakovic (Sardor Qulmatov, 60), Josip Tomasevic, Izzatillo Polatov, Javohir Roziyev, Ravshan Khayrullayev (Frane Chiriak, 60), Shakhboz Jurabekov (Bilol Tupliev, 82), Toma Tabatadze (Dominik Begic, 82), Azizbek Amonov.
